Verdict

Honolulu, HI offers better overall compensation for elementary school teachers,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to Kaneohe.

The salary gap between Honolulu and Kaneohe is $5,423 (7.08%). Honolulu's median is +26.94% compared to the US national median of $64,597.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Honolulu spans $69,716,Kaneohe spans $59,291. Honolulu has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 0.98%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
